Disclaimer

It not recommended to run Mutiny on multiple devices, this can cause force closures and in the worst case a loss of funds. Recovery should only be done when necessary, not to run the same wallet across many devices.

On-chain

Mutiny uses taproot addresses for its on-chain wallet. This means funds are stored using the derivation path m/86'/0'/0'.

A lot of wallets do not support taproot yet, if you are trying to restore your on-chain balance outside of Mutiny, we recommend using Sparrow Wallet.

Lightning

Lightning relies on having the most up-to-date state in order to recover your funds, if you have an older version of your state, it can lead to a loss of funds.

In order to protect against this Mutiny duplicates it lightning state to an encrypted cloud storage called VSS. Your lightning state is encrypted to your seed so if you have your seed phrase, you should be able to recover your lightning funds. However, this is not 100% reliable and is not recommended to rely on, you should try your best to not lose your local state.
